Point B Acquires TNG Digital Experience Studio

Firm expands and rapidly grows digital capabilities during one of the most transformative waves of change for customers

PORTLAND, Ore.--()--Point B Inc., an integrated management consulting, venture investment, and property development firm, has acquired TNG, a digital experience design studio with a 23-year history of success in helping companies increase innovation and agility in their content, communications and culture to drive exceptional digital user experiences. The acquisition of TNG complements and extends Point B’s award-winning expertise in strategic delivery, bringing customers the in-depth creative, development and technology capabilities they need to respond to the rapid pace of digital transformation.

Point B’s acquisition of TNG also includes the purchase of their historic office building located in the South Waterfront/John’s Landing neighborhood of Portland, Oregon. This property offers long-term strategic opportunities for Point B and complements the firm’s existing real estate investments in Oregon.
